OGG is for metadata too

OGG is a media container format. But it is also supposed to contain metadata; information describing the media it contains. But there is no standard at all for including metadata in OGG containers. I want to change that.

Update: Got it's own page on the Xiph wiki.

I have submitted an general idea for a XML based way of marking up metadata to Xiph.Org Foundation's ogg-dev mailinglist. My contribution can be found in the ogg-dev web archive for 2007-09.
